How were Theodore Roosevelt’s ideas on the role of government apparent early in his political career?

History
2 answers:
Nadusha1986 [10]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

Early in his political career Theodore Roosevelt's ideas on the role of government were apparent because of his interest in fighting corruption. He was also interested in reforming government.
